Another case of a severely overdue library book making its way home.
Alvin M. Josephy’s book The Patriot Chiefs, which had been checked out on March 16, 1978, was returned to the Arlington Central Library (Virginia) last Tuesday. A letter of apology and a cheque for $25 came along with the book.
70-year-old Sarah McKee said that she was embarrassed when she recently opened the book and discovered that it belonged to the library. Citing a poor memory, McKee said, “I never would have schlepped it around all these years had I not thought it was mine.”
